Energy specialists are calling for the United Kingdom to shift its focus toward biomethane as a critical solution for expanding the nation's gas supply. This approach emphasizes sources that are both domestically produced and renewable, moving away from reliance on imported liquefied natural gas or increased North Sea drilling.
The Essential Role of Gas in the UK Energy System
Gas remains a fundamental component of the UK's energy infrastructure, particularly for heating homes and ensuring power system resilience. However, dependence on volatile global markets for liquefied natural gas exposes the country to significant price fluctuations and potential supply disruptions. This vulnerability underscores the need for more stable and secure energy alternatives.
Biomethane: A Domestic and Sustainable Alternative
Biomethane presents a compelling third option that is often overlooked in energy discussions. Produced through anaerobic digestion of organic wastes, this renewable gas can be injected directly into the existing national gas grid. Unlike traditional fossil fuels, biomethane offers multiple advantages:
- Fully Domestic Production: All biomethane is generated within the UK, eliminating dependence on international shipping routes and geopolitical tensions.
- Low Carbon Footprint: The production process significantly reduces greenhouse gas emissions compared to fossil gas extraction.
- Storage and Dispatch Capability: Biomethane can be stored and deployed when needed, providing reliable energy during peak demand periods.
International Examples and Climate Commitments
Several European nations have successfully integrated biomethane into their energy strategies. Denmark now meets 40% of its total gas demand through green gas sources, while France has experienced annual biomethane growth exceeding 20% since Russia's invasion of Ukraine in 2022. The International Energy Agency's 2025 Renewables report identifies biomethane as the fastest-growing renewable energy source necessary for achieving net zero emissions targets.
Economic and Environmental Benefits
Prioritizing biomethane development would deliver substantial advantages across multiple sectors:
- Enhanced Energy Security: Reducing import dependence strengthens national energy independence.
- Emission Reduction: Supporting climate commitments through lower-carbon energy production.
- Rural Economic Support: Creating sustainable jobs in agriculture and waste management industries.
- Infrastructure Utilization: Leveraging existing gas distribution networks without requiring massive new investments.
The transition toward biomethane represents a practical pathway for blending green alternatives with conventional gas supplies. Energy security objectives should not focus solely on increasing fossil gas production but rather on systematically replacing it with renewable alternatives wherever feasible. The primary barrier to scaling biomethane in the UK appears to be political will rather than technological or economic limitations.
